using System;
using System.Diagnostics;
using System.Globalization;
using System.IO;
using System.Text;
using System.Text.RegularExpressions;
using System.Threading;
using Newtonsoft.Json.Linq;
using youtube_dl_viewer.Util;
namespace youtube_dl_viewer.Jobs
{
public class ConvertJob : Job
{
public readonly string Destination;
public readonly string Temp;
public readonly int DataDirIndex;
public readonly string VideoUID;
private (int, int) _progress = (0, 1);
public override (int, int) Progress => _progress;
public ConvertJob(AbsJobManager man, string src, string dst, int ddindex, string viduid) : base(man, src)
{
Destination = dst;
DataDirIndex = ddindex;
VideoUID = viduid;
Temp = Path.Combine(Path.GetTempPath(), "yt_dl_v_" + Guid.NewGuid().ToString("B") + ".webm");
}
public override string Name => $"Convert::'{Path.GetFileName(Source)}'";
protected override void Run()
{
Process proc = null;
var start = DateTime.Now;
try
{
if (!Program.HasValidFFMPEG) throw new Exception("no ffmpeg");
var (ecode1, outputProbe) = FFMPEGUtil.RunCommand(Program.Args.FFPROBEExec, $" -v error -show_entries format=duration -of default=noprint_wrappers=1:nokey=1 \"{Source}\"", "prevgen-probe");
if (AbortRequest) { ChangeState(JobState.Aborted); return; }
if (ecode1 != 0)
{
Console.Error.WriteLine($"Job [{Name}] failed (non-zero exit code in ffprobe)");
ChangeState(JobState.Failed);
return;
}
var videolen = double.Parse(outputProbe.Trim(), CultureInfo.InvariantCulture);
var cmd = $" -i \"{Source}\" -f webm -vcodec libvpx-vp9 {Program.Args.ConvertFFMPEGParams} {Temp}";
proc = new Process
{
StartInfo = new ProcessStartInfo
{
FileName = Program.Args.FFMPEGExec,
Arguments = cmd,
CreateNoWindow = true,
RedirectStandardOutput = true,
RedirectStandardError = true,
}
};
var builderOut = new StringBuilder();
proc.OutputDataReceived += (sender, args) =>
{
if (args.Data == null) return;
if (builderOut.Length == 0) builderOut.Append(args.Data);
else builderOut.Append("\n" + args.Data);
ParseFFMpegOutputLine(args, videolen);
};
proc.ErrorDataReceived += (sender, args) =>
{
if (args.Data == null) return;
if (builderOut.Length == 0) builderOut.Append(args.Data);
else builderOut.Append("\n" + args.Data);
ParseFFMpegOutputLine(args, videolen);
};
proc.Start();
proc.BeginOutputReadLine();
proc.BeginErrorReadLine();
while (!File.Exists(Temp))
{
if (AbortRequest) return;
if (proc.HasExited && !File.Exists(Temp))
{
ChangeState(JobState.Failed);
return;
}
Thread.Sleep(0);
}
for (;;) // Wait for ffmpeg
{
if (AbortRequest) { ChangeState(JobState.Aborted); return; }
if (proc.HasExited) break;
Thread.Sleep(100);
}
if (Program.Args.FFMPEGDebugDir != null)
{
File.WriteAllText(Path.Combine(Program.Args.FFMPEGDebugDir, $"{start:yyyy-MM-dd_HH-mm-ss.fffffff}_[convert].log"), $"> {Program.Args.FFMPEGExec} {cmd}\nExitCode:{proc.ExitCode}\nStart:{start:yyyy-MM-dd HH:mm:ss}\nEnd:{DateTime.Now:yyyy-MM-dd HH:mm:ss}\n\n{builderOut}");
}
if (proc.ExitCode != 0)
{
Console.Error.WriteLine($"Job [{Name}] failed (non-zero exit code)");
ChangeState(JobState.Failed);
}
else
{
ChangeState(JobState.Finished);
_progress = (1, 1);
while (ProxyCount != 0) // Wait for proxies
{
if (AbortRequest) { ChangeState(JobState.Aborted); return; }
Thread.Sleep(100);
}
lock (SuperLock)
{
if (Destination != null)
{
for (var i = 0; i < 15; i++) // 15 retries
{
if (AbortRequest) { ChangeState(JobState.Aborted); return; }
try
{
File.Move(Temp, Destination);
if (File.Exists(Destination) && new FileInfo(Destination).Length == 0) File.Delete(Destination);
Program.PatchDataCache(DataDirIndex, VideoUID, new[]{"meta", "cached"}, true);
Program.PatchDataCache(DataDirIndex, VideoUID, new[]{"meta", "cache_file"}, Destination);
break;
}
catch (IOException)
{
Console.Error.WriteLine("Move of converted file to cache failed ... retry in 2 secs");
Thread.Sleep(2 * 1000);
}
}
}
}
ChangeState(JobState.Success);
}
}
finally
{
if (State == JobState.Running) ChangeState(JobState.Failed); // just to be sure
if (proc != null && !proc.HasExited)
{
proc.Kill(true);
Thread.Sleep(500);
}
for (var i = 0;; i++)
{
try
{
if (File.Exists(Temp)) File.Delete(Temp);
break;
}
catch (IOException)
{
Console.Error.WriteLine("Delete of converted file (temp dir) failed ... retry in 3 secs");
Thread.Sleep(3 * 1000);
}
if (i == 10) // 10 retries
{
Console.Error.WriteLine("Delete of converted file (temp dir) failed finally");
break;
}
}
}
}
private void ParseFFMpegOutputLine(DataReceivedEventArgs args, double videolen)
{
if (args.Data.StartsWith("frame="))
{
var match = Regex.Match(args.Data, @"time=(?<time>[0-9]{2}:[0-9]{2}:[0-9]{2}.[0-9]{2})");
if (match.Success)
{
var time = TimeSpan.Parse(match.Groups["time"].Value);
_progress = ((int) Math.Floor((time.TotalSeconds / videolen) * 1000), 1000);
}
}
}
public override JObject AsJson(string managerName, string queue)
{
var obj = base.AsJson(managerName, queue);
obj.Add(new JProperty("Destination", Destination));
obj.Add(new JProperty("Temp", Temp));
return obj;
}
}
}
